Efficacy of Vevye Ophthalmic Solution for the Treatment of Meibomian Gland Dysfunction

This research study evaluates a prescription eye drop called Vevye® (cyclosporine 0.1%) for adults who have meibomian gland dysfunction (MGD), a common eye condition that can cause dry, irritated, or burning eyes. If you join the study, after a short "run-in" period using artificial tears, you will receive Vevye twice a day for about 24 weeks (approximately six months). During that time you will attend several clinic visits where your eye symptoms, lid health, tear film, and meibomian gland function will be assessed. The goal is to learn whether Vevye improves symptoms (like eye dryness or irritation) and signs (such as changes on the eye's surface or lid margins) of MGD. You will also be monitored for safety and comfort of the eye drop. The information obtained from this study may help determine whether this treatment is beneficial for people with this condition and contribute to future care options. Participation is voluntary and you may stop at any time.
